RB Leipzig are adamant that Liverpool target Yan Diomande is going nowhere this summer. The Reds are believed to be pursuing the 19-year-old Ivory Coast international and are prepared to rival Paris Saint-Germain for his signature.However, Leipzig chiefs are ready to swat away big-money offers after securing Champions League qualification. Their hardline stance could therefore hamper Liverpool's chances of landing the skilful teenager and also complicate the picture for PSG's Bradley Barcola, who is also on Liverpool's radar, along with new Premier League champions Arsenal.PSG are primed to consider offers for Barcola if they can land £85million-rated Diomande, who is also at the centre of a legal dispute.

The forward signed with Jay-Z's agency Roc Nation Sports in February, but rival company Maxidel - owned by ex-Leeds man Max Gradel - claim Diomande is still "contractually bound" to their stable.

At the beginning of the year, Maxidel claimed they'd renewed terms with the Ivorian gem before he allegedly changed representatives.

The ECHO's sister paper, the Mirror, understands that The Court of Arbitration for Sport is now investigating and has registered a case which will require Diomade to comply.It's partially why there is a firm chance he will stay put in Germany. Manchester United had also shown interest, which has now cooled as they're prioritising a midfield overhaul.

Arne Slot has confirmed that Liverpool will be working to sign "at least one" winger this summer, following the departure of Mohamed Salah.

"One of the reasons why everyone is talking about wingers is because Mo is leaving," Slot said.

"It makes complete sense to think about at least one. I think last season gives you the answer. How important were our wingers last season for our success.

"They were scoring goals, providing goals, so they were a vital part of us winning the league last season and, in general in football, you see more and more focus on wingers."
